Certified Refurbished: Each unit is professionally inspected, tested, and restored by our expert team to meet strict performance standards. Works like new, but may show scratches or imperfections.
Unleash Powerful Cleaning: With Ultra-Strong 5,000 Pa Suction, this eufy robot vacuum L60 effortlessly removes hair, crumbs, and dust in just one pass, ensuring a spotless living space.
Conquer Obstacles: Capable of climbing up to 20 mm, the eufy robot vacuum L60 easily overcomes thresholds and carpet edges without getting stuck, ensuring extended cleaning coverage.
Experience Intelligent Suction Control: BoostIQ Technology in the eufy robot vacuum L60automatically increases suction power when needed, ensuring maximum cleaning efficiency on all types of surfaces.
Customize Your Cleaning: AI.Map 2.0 allows for specific room selection, No-Go Zone setup, and Multi-Floor Mapping, offering a personalized cleaning experience right from the app with our eufy robot vacuum L60.
Enjoy Efficient Navigation: The eufy robot vacuum’s Precision Mapping with iPath Laser Navigation uses advanced Lidar technology, creating accurate maps for efficient cleaning routes around your home.

    Jury is still out
    I really didn’t want to purchase another Eufy product. I’m very mad at them because they’re security doorbell cameras failing so readily (like a hardwired doorbell that stops working and gives me the input that there’s no batteries even after we had it rewired.) And I caution everyone I am not a fan of their customer service anymore.Years ago it used to be fantastic. It is rare today, when you send in a request for help that anyone fully reads what your expressing. You get scripted answers or links to technical information that you’ve already told them in previous communications you’ve tried.Anyway… We have a dumber, earlier version of the Eufy vacuum cleaner that is about 5 years old –recently replaced the battery because I really love how well it draws up dirt and hair… Though the little chamber constantly gets jam-packed and the machine always gets stuck. I decided to move that one upstairs and get a smarter vac (only) and looked into several that could manage pet hair and that had good mapping and the ability to avoid scooping up toys etc.What I like is the software’s easy (much friendlier than Narwal!). I think the mapping was perfect right out of the gate.Ease of splitting out larger areas into rooms is just wonderful.The on-screen guidance as you’re using this software is mostly excellent.I really like how you can choose a setting that the vacuum will go to recharge and re-start itself back into motion to finish the job that wasn’t finished when it went kaput.I like that you can choose the frequency of having the vacuum empty into the charging station.These two features that I just mentioned are a little bit hidden under settings. I think tabs would be nice for some pictures like this.I don’t like that it only has one rotating brush. The older Eufy has two and I think it’s a much better design to sweep things into the suction range.I like the quiet of this vacuum. The older version was quiet and this one is quieter yet.As a matter of fact it worries me because the difference in suction sound makes it seem as though it really isn’t changing at all.I am not so sure the suction is as effective as It’s been bragged about in its right up and in other reviews… it’s actually gone over places on my carpet and it really didn’t pull up all the fur. (That is in the video)I have also watched it go over small pieces of cardboard from a scratching post and it didn’t pick it up… Again if the brush was there on that side it would have been pushed into the suction path better.I am not a fan of how it seems to not know how to avoid things. When setting up and getting ready to map your home with the LIDAR, the guidance is to take everything off the floor that is possible. Of course I put things back down like the tall cat toy that that has absolute presence, no different than a small cat –and the vacuum just runs right into it and starts pushing it…Our cat food bowls and water bowls just get pushed around. And the vacuum simply runs right into any toy and doesn’t bother going around any of it so I would be sure you DO NOT BUY THIS IF YOU HAVE A CAT OR DOG THAT LEAVES MESSES ON THE FLOOR!Also on some things that were not picked up like the kitchen table, I don’t get how come this vacuum just runs into it with full speed. Also it is very weird that it has a real problem transitioning to rugs. I have a leather throw rug that stays in place with people and animals going across it. But this machine’s able to nose it up into the air and then get tangled in it. It means that when I have my schedule in place I have to roll up this carpet and my toilet carpets. As you can guess it’s annoying.I also found it odd that when I’m trying to have it avoid going over something I will stand in place and despite the fact that it is vacuuming according to a grid it actually came back and circled and bumped into my feet five times before it finally gave up. What if that was an animal that was standing there? Would it bump into it also?There are reviews on here that are so much more detailed. All I can say is I tried a Roomba (returned it to store) and I tried the Narwal (The mapping was awful and I returned that one also.)I’m simply not wanting to return another vacuum. I do want to note that I purchased this one and accidentally ordered a ‘used’ model which means somebody else returned it. I have a feeling it has to do with this weird occasional click click click sound that makes it sound as though something is stuck in the rollers or something to that effect.Now that I finished muddling through this review I do know that this week I’ll be getting in touch with Eufy. I can’t help but wonder is this really the way this thing is supposed to be working.Oh, I did get the setup with the vacuum bag tower. As others have said it is extremely loud. The feature that reportedly cuts cat hair also has some volume to it, but for all its noise I don’t think it really cuts but maybe 50% of the hair. I still have to manually clean the roll brush frequently. See photo.

    Buy it! Its a great deal and works amazingly!
    PEPE! Our little mule has been working like a charm for almost 9 months. He cleans hardwoods great and also lightly cleans carpet(I would suggest running the vacuum cleaner like once a month for a deep clean). No major issues. Hopefully Pepe will be with us for a ling time. I like the fact that it tells you how often to service different items on the vacuum. It maps well and hooks up tothe internet quite well. I will note that you will need to adjust router to 2.4ghz initially to connect,then it should work fine with any dual band router. Pete has been a great addition to the home. We got the base station and it’s a lifesaver for not having to empty the debris bin often and the cutting wheel is a nice added touch. Some may think it’s loud at times, but the auto suction adjustment is a nice feature so it get quiter if the extra suction isn’t needed.I would buy again and again. We specifically chose notto get a mop version, but to each their own. Enjoy!Tip: 1) Keep up with periodically cleaning hair from the main brush, side sweeper, and front caster wheel. If you don’t it will not clean as well, bit once you learn how often you need to do it all becomes ezmode.2) clean off the air filter routinely.3) go ahead and buy the replacement kit so you’ll have all the bits and pieces on hand when and if it needs to be changed out.

    I think it’s important to keep your expectations in check when looking at a vacuum like this. Is it going to perfectly vacuum your entire house and keep it absolutely spotless? No. But is it going to do a good job of doing a daily sweep to greatly reduce dust and dirt accumulation? Yes! It’s one of the least expensive vacuums, let alone robot vacuums on the market from what I’ve seen. I got a “renewed” one, which looked brand new and clean like it had never been used for less than $150CAD. The unit is surprisingly small and low, allowing it to crawl under beds and other pieces of furniture without issue. It’s also quite quiet, although not unnoticeable.This unit doesn’t have any cameras to allow for more advanced mapping techniques, so it sort of just wanders around bumping into stuff. However, it doesn’t do this completely at random, as it clearly can determine where edges and corners are, and follow and sweep / vacuum them, which is really good. However, it can sometimes get stuck in certain places like between chair legs. It’s obviously not the most cutting edge or advanced robot vacuum on the market, but it’s priced accordingly. It does a great job of picking up cat hair, dust, dirt, and other debris. It’s also quite entertaining to watch it go around bumping into things. It also doubles as great entertainment for my cat, who chases it around and swats at it constantly. I was worried he’d be afraid of the thing, but it’s definitely the most entertaining thing for my cat, which is an added bonus!Overall, if you have mainly hard flooring or low carpet, and have a smaller house or apartment, I think this is an ideal unit. It can get hung up on rugs or other cloth items left on the floor. It usually returns to its charging station, but sometimes just stops wherever it is. I’m not sure if this is because of the odd shape of my kitchen where I’ve placed its charging station. It also won’t fall down stairs or other ledges as it has a sensor for this, but will go down small ledges. (but not back up, necessarily!)Noise: Quite quietSuction: AdequateBattery life: More than adequate (for the size of my place)Thoroughness: GoodUsefulness: VeryCat entertainment ability: ExcellentValue: Amazing, considering you can hardly get a handheld vac for this price
